SWWC13P7E2BC Overview

FIBER OPTIC SPLITTER/COUPLER, 1X3PORT, 70/15, ST CONNECTOR

SWWC13P7E2BC Parametric

Parameter NameAttribute value
MakerLightel Technologies Inc.
Reach Compliance Codeunknown
Connection TypeST CONNECTOR
Fiber optic equipment typesSPLITTER/COUPLER
Fiber typeSMF-28
Maximum insertion loss5.5 dB
Maximum operating temperature85 °C
Minimum operating temperature-40 °C
Nominal operating wavelength1310 nm
Port configuration1X3
minimum return loss50 dB
Split ratio/coupling ratio70/15
